Undergraduates Taking Graduate Level Courses - Temple University

https://bulletin.temple.edu/undergraduate/academic-policies/undergraduate-credit-graduate-level-courses/

Students may take 5000-level graduate courses with the permission of the instructor and the dean's designee for undergraduate credit. Students who wish to take higher-level graduate courses (>5000-level) must have the permission of the instructor, the dean's designee for undergraduate credit, the Office of Undergraduate Studies, and the Graduate School. Liberles Research Group - Sites

https://sites.temple.edu/liberles/

The Liberles Research Group works in the areas of computational comparative genomics, and molecular evolution. The central theme in the research group is the detection and characterization of the lineage-specific divergence of protein-encoding genes. Housing - School of Podiatric Medicine

https://podiatry.temple.edu/student-life/housing

Housing Temple University School of Podiatric Medicine's on-campus housing complex comprises 72 fully furnished apartments with coin-operated laundry facilities, study areas, and common social areas. Residents provide their linens and do their housekeeping. The complex is designed to provide maximum security while offering convenient living arrangements.
